Is there a way to apply to more than one college for the same term in the Los Angeles Community College District? The district includes community colleges like LA Harbor college, LA Southwest, and LA Valley. The thing is I want to apply to ADN programs for entry into the fall. If I choose the same term to apply for entry like Summer 2015 for one college and apply to another college for Summer 2015 as well, it won't let me and gives me an error that I can only apply to one college in the LACCD per term. If you are trying to apply to the school in general then you really only need to apply to one school in the district and then you are in the system and can take classes at any of the campuses.

As for the nursing programs, yes you can apply to more than one campus /school for each term but you don't do it online like for general admission. Applying to the nursing program involves meeting with a nursing counselor and getting approved for eligibility to apply to the nursing program (usually is a form you get signed and take to the nursing department). The nursing department will then give you the application with directions on how to complete it. You usually hand deliver all documents (application and transcripts) directly to the nursing department but it may be different at some schools. I've only looked into LACC, LATT, LACH, & ELAC.

Well, technically only eight because L.A.M.C. doesn't have a nursing program. I've applied to Pierce and Valley. Each has different application periods. Currently, Pierce is accepting applications till February 15(?) Valley will be in a couple of months. Also, each school has a different procedure that one must follow regarding submission of transcripts, applications, letters of recommendation etc. Go to each school's internet page and search their nursing department for exact info.
